WebThe overthrow of the Hawaiian Kingdom was an illegal coup d'état against Queen Liliʻuokalani, which took place on January 17, 1893, on the island of Oahu and led by the Committee of Safety, composed of seven foreign residents and six Hawaiian Kingdom subjects of American descent in Honolulu. While every enterprise is different, the principles of small business security are universal, whether it’s a clothing store, hair salon or IT consultancy.
